Position: Part-Time Project Administrator, Bath (temporary)

REED Business Support in Bath is excited to have won a new client with offices based in Bath in their search for a Part-Time Project Administrator.

This is a temporary role starting on 6th July until the end of August / September

£14.00 - £14.75

Part-time - 22.5 hours per week

This role is to support a small team and is crucial in delivering and developing a programme for support workers of friends and family.

Day-to-day of the role:

  • Support the Project Team in setting up both online and offline support interventions.
  • Consult with staff, volunteers and participants to schedule activities, research and book venues, and liaise with attendees, volunteers and speakers.
  • Ensure materials, forms, merchandise and refreshments are ordered, delivered on time and within budget and transported efficiently to venues.
  • Manage data collection, storage, and reporting to ensure efficient and secure handling of participant and enquiry data.
  • Gather stories, testimonials and images from beneficiaries, maintaining records of permissions for use.
  • Organise and minute team meetings to ensure clarity of actions.
  • Provide administrative support to the Project Team and attend events and course sessions to ensure smooth operation.

Required Skills & Qualifications:

  • Excellent administration and organisational skills.
  • Proven experience in delivering exceptional customer service.
  • Strong relationship-building skills with experience in data entry, monitoring and report generation.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, PowerPoint, Excel, Outlook) and experience with database/CRM systems.
  • Polite, professional manner with empathy and ability to communicate effectively with diverse groups.
  • Good time management skills, ability to prioritise a busy workload, and work independently.
